+Sitronix ST7735R display panels
+
+This binding is for display panels using a Sitronix ST7735R controller in SPI
+mode.
+
+Required properties:
+- compatible:  "sitronix,st7735r-jd-t18003-t01"
+- dc-gpios:    Display data/command selection (D/CX)
+- reset-gpios: Reset signal (RSTX)
+
+The node for this driver must be a child node of a SPI controller, hence
+all mandatory properties described in ../spi/spi-bus.txt must be specified.
+
+Optional properties:
+- rotation:    panel rotation in degrees counter clockwise (0,90,180,270)
+- backlight:   phandle of the backlight device attached to the panel
+
+Example:
+
+       backlight: backlight {
+               compatible = "gpio-backlight";
+               gpios = <&gpio 44 GPIO_ACTIVE_HIGH>;
+       }
+
+       ...
+
+       display@0{
+               compatible = "sitronix,st7735r-jd-t18003-t01";
+               reg = <0>;
+               spi-max-frequency = <32000000>;
+               dc-gpios = <&gpio 43 GPIO_ACTIVE_HIGH>;
+               reset-gpios = <&gpio 80 GPIO_ACTIVE_HIGH>;
+               rotation = <270>;
+               backlight = &backlight;
+       };
